I am trying to insert a video clip into
a powerpoint presentation. I have tried
the two normal ways to do this but when
I insert object.....
I get the message "video not available,
cannot find 'vids:mjpg' decompressor".
Can anyone tell me how to rememdy this?
The file will play using media player.
I can isert the object to play in
media player format, but I want the power
point program to open it so it doesn't show
all the media player borders and such.
